2009 Ballon d’Or top 10 list revealed
#10
Messi a deserved winner. The 22-year-old became the first Ballon d'Or winner from Argentina, eclipsing runner-up and last year's winner Cristiano Ronaldo by a record 240-point margin.
The award's 96 jurors gave Messi 473 points out of a possible 480, a near unanimous verdict, organisers France Football said.
The win caps a brilliant year for the softly-spoken left-footed forward.
He helped Barcelona to the Champions League title with nine goals - including one in the final against Manchester United - as well as bagging six in the Copa del Rey and 23 in La Liga.
The gong, formerly known as the European Footballer of the Year award, was voted on by journalists from across the world.

Full points scoring list:

1. Lionel Messi (Argentine, FC Barcelone) : 473 points
2. 2. Cristiano Ronaldo (Portugal, Man Utd plus Real Madrid) : 233
3. 3. Xavi (Espagne, FC Barcelone) : 170 pts
4. 4. Andrès Iniesta (Espagnol, FC Barcelone) : 149
5. 5. Samuel Eto’o (Cameroun, FC Barcelone puis Inter Milan) : 75 pts
6. 6. Kaka (Brésil, Milan AC puis Real Madrid) : 58 pts
7. 7. Zlatan Ibrahimovic (Suède, Inter Milan puis FC Barcelone) : 50 pts
8. 8. Wayne Rooney (Angleterre, Manchester United): 35 pts
9. 9. Didier Drogba (Côte d’Ivoire, Chelsea): 33 pts
10. 10. Steven Gerrard (Angleterre, Liverpool) : 32 pts
11. 11. Fernando Torres (Espagne, Liverpool): 22 pts
12. 12. Cesc Fabregas (Espagne, Arsenal) : 13 pts
13. 13. Edin Dzeko (Bosnie, Wolfsburg) : 12 pts
14. 14. Ryan Giggs (Pays de Galles, Manchester United) : 11 pts
15. 15. Thierry Henry (France, FC Barcelone) : 9 pts
16. 16. Luis Fabiano (Brésil, FC Séville), Nemanja Vidic (Serbie, Manchester United), Iker Casillas (Espagne, Real Madrid): 8 pts
19. 19. Diego Forlan (Uruguay, Atletico Madrid) : 7 pts
20. 20. Yoann Gourcuff (France, Bordeaux) : 6 pts
21. 21. Andreï Archavine (Russie, Arsenal), Julio Cesar (Brésil, Inter Milan), Frank Lampard (Angleterre, Chelsea) : 5 pts
24. 24. Maicon (Brésil, Inter Milan) : 4 pts
25. 25. Diego (Brésil, Werder Brême puis Juventus Turin) : 3 pts
26. 26. David Villa (Espagne, Valence), John Terry (Angleterre, Chelsea) : 2 pts
28. 28. Franck Ribéry (France, Bayern Munich), Yaya Touré (Côte d’Ivoire, FC Barcelone) : 1 pt
30. 30. Karim Benzema (France, Lyon puis Real Madrid): 0 ptt
